医院 数据库

SQL0968C 文件系统已满。 SQLSTATE=57011

我是刚刚接触db2的新手,我在恢复数据库的时候使用db2 "restore database BDCC60 from C:databakpzyydb  taken at 20110907030003 logtarget C:databakpzyydblogs without prompting"这个命令,然后提示SQL0968C  文件系统已满。  SQLSTATE=5... 显示全部
我是刚刚接触db2的新手,我在恢复数据库的时候使用db2 "restore database BDCC60 from C:databakpzyydb  taken at 20110907030003 logtarget C:databakpzyydblogs without prompting"这个命令,然后提示SQL0968C  文件系统已满。  SQLSTATE=57011,我在网上找了很久都没有找到解决的方法,请问这个问题该如何解决? 收起
参与4

查看其它 2 个回答glluys 的回答

glluys glluys 系统工程师 桂宇公司
这个问题我也遇到了,一直没解决。我的平台是AIX5.2+DB2 V7.2,源数据库数据量有400G,在RESTORE恢复到一个新建的同名数据库的时候就提示sql0968c.
1、开始的时候以为是AIX下面ulimit限制了,于是把ulimit里的相关参数都设成不受限的-1,没有用。
2、百度了一些相关资料,说是可能是临时表空间太小。于是把临时表空间从3G,一直调到10G,并且在RESTORE DB过程中一直用df -k命令查看临时表空间所在文件系统的使用率,一直都是1%,还是出现SQL0968C的提示
汽车 · 2015-06-25
浏览5366

回答者

glluys
系统工程师 桂宇公司
评论12

glluys 最近回答过的问题

回答状态

  • 发布时间:2015-06-25
  • 关注会员:1 人
  • 回答浏览:5366
  • X社区推广